Print quality and color settings

Printing Line Drawings in Monochrome

The following settings are available for monochrome printing of line drawings.

Easy
Settings

Print
Target

CAD
(Monochrome
Line Drawing )

Settings optimized for monochrome printing of line drawings,
such as CAD drawings. When you select Easy Settings >
Print Target > CAD (Monochrome Line Drawing ), color is
printed as shades of gray using black ink, for monochrome
printing.

This mode may not be available for all types of paper.

Trace amounts of color ink are also used, to enhance the

paper adhesion of black ink.

Monochrome
(BK ink)

Monochrome printing, using black ink. Color is printed in
grayscale. Use this mode when printing CAD drawings or
similar line drawings in monochrome.

This mode may not be available for all types of paper.

Trace amounts of color ink are also used, to enhance the

paper adhesion of black ink.

Main

Advanced
Settings

Color
Mode

Monochrome
Bitmap

All colors except white are printed in black. Colors are
shown not in grayscale but solid black. Use this mode to
print documents with ne color lines that might be difcult to
distinguish unless printed in black, or to print sharp black lines
when making copies of diazo prints.

This mode may not be available for all types of paper.

Trace amounts of color ink are also used, to enhance the

paper adhesion of black ink.
